Boom Merchant Ignites the Dancefloor with Suena Bien

A powerful four-track techno EP packed with energy, groove, and global flavor.

Fresh off a string of intense shows in Mexico, the Mexico-based, Ireland-born artist Boom Merchant is back on the production side. This time, he delivers a deep techno four-tracker titled Suena Bien. He describes the EP as “Tough, driving, groovy percussion and slamming low end.”

The title track kicks off the EP with peaking drums, pitched and shuffling hats, and haunting synths. The breakdown transports you straight into a peak-time techno warehouse set—it’s pure class. You’ll be shouting, “One water, please!” as the energy ramps up.

Then comes “Sparkle,” a standout from the rest of the EP. “Sparkle is definitely the track on the EP with the most oldskool influence, and the most traditional sound and feel. The euphoric piano and soulful vocals play off one another to give it quite a gospel sound,” the artist shares.

Fourth Wind” gives you a moment to breathe—but it’s far from a cooldown. With its pounding kick drum and dynamic, textured arrangement, the momentum doesn’t let up.

- Advertisement -

Finally, “Red Sun Dub” closes the EP with an evolving arrangement, a hard-hitting kick drum, and a squelchy acid bassline.

Boom Merchant continues to channel his creativity through Tribal Pulse, a label that has been going from strength to strength for well over a decade. It’s the place where he’s released some of his most out-there tracks, and in recent years, it has also been a frequent home for artists like Homma Honganji, Hockins, and Obsidian Wave.

Tribal Pulse is more than a label—it’s a global family, constantly growing with fresh talent like Lefrenk and iluna joining the roster. While a large portion of his work is released via Tribal Pulse, Boom Merchant has also explored other platforms.

In the past year alone, he’s dropped EPs on T78’s Autektone Dark, Sisko Elektrofanatik’s Gain Plus, LaLa’s Brand New Records, and a few other notable imprints.
